Why Energy Storage Matters in Egypt
With solar and wind capacity growing at 15% annually since 2020, Egypt faces a critical need to balance intermittent renewable generation. Centralized storage systems – think of them as giant "energy banks" – help:
- Smooth out solar power fluctuations during sandstorms
- Store excess wind energy at night for daytime use
- Provide backup power during peak demand (which jumped 22% in 2023 alone)
Flagship Projects Shaping Egypt's Grid
1. Benban Solar Park Storage Expansion
Adjacent to Africa's largest solar farm (1.8GW), this 260MWh battery system acts like a shock absorber for the national grid. During testing phases, it successfully:
- Reduced curtailment by 40%
- Extended solar delivery into evening hours
Key Project Data
Capacity | Technology | Completion |
---|---|---|
260MWh | Lithium-ion | Q3 2024 |
2. Red Sea Wind-Storage Hybrid System
This innovative project combines 500MW wind turbines with a 120MWh flow battery system. Picture it as a tag-team between nature and technology – capturing gusty desert winds while ensuring steady power output.
Emerging Storage Technologies
Egypt's storage mix is diversifying beyond conventional batteries:
- Pumped Hydro: The 2.4GW Attaqa facility (2026 completion) will store enough water to power Cairo for 8 hours
- Thermal Storage: Concentrated solar plants now retain heat for 10+ hours after sunset

Challenges and Opportunities
While progress is impressive, hurdles remain:
- High upfront costs (storage projects require $80-120/kWh investment)
- Grid modernization needs
But opportunities abound:
- EU funding for cross-Mediterranean energy sharing
- Falling battery prices (33% drop since 2020)

Future Outlook
Egypt aims to deploy 3GW of storage capacity by 2030. Upcoming developments include:
- Suez Canal Economic Zone storage hubs
- Green hydrogen storage pilot projects
